1. Biochemistry: The Science Running Every Cell in Your Body Diabetes is not just "high blood sugar." It is a breakdown in how insulin signals glucose transport at the molecular level — a metabolic pathway failure that biochemists understand precisely. Cancer is not just abnormal cell growth. It is mutations in oncogenes, disrupted apoptosis pathways, and altered metabolic reprogramming — all biochemical events. Even COVID-19 — the defining global health crisis of recent years — was decoded, tracked, and combated largely through molecular and biochemical tools. Biochemistry is the science that explains what disease actually is at the level where it originates — the cell, the molecule, the metabolic pathway. And in a world where personalised medicine, molecular diagnostics, gene therapy, and precision oncology are rapidly becoming mainstream, the demand for trained medical biochemists has never been greater or more consequential. 1. Physiology as the Core of Medical Science Physiology constitutes the fundamental scientific framework upon which all medical disciplines are constructed. A precise understanding of normal physiological processes is indispensable for identifying deviations that manifest as disease. The transition from health to pathology can only be interpreted accurately when the underlying mechanisms governing cellular, organ, and systemic function are clearly understood. Modern advances in clinical medicine, pharmacotherapy, and critical care are deeply rooted in physiological principles. Cardiac electrophysiology explains arrhythmogenesis and guides interventions; renal physiology underpins fluid-electrolyte management and acid–base balance; neurophysiology elucidates synaptic transmission and neural integration. These are not isolated concepts but interconnected processes that sustain homeostasis. Physiology, therefore, functions as an integrative and translational science, bridging basic biomedical knowledge with clinical application. It informs diagnostic reasoning, supports evidence-based therapeutics, and drives innovation in biomedical research. The M.Sc. Overview of M.Sc. Medical Physiology The M.Sc. Medical Physiology is a three-year postgraduate programme (six semesters) structured under the Choice Based Credit System (CBCS). It is delivered in a regular, full-time mode by the Department of Physiology. The programme provides advanced training in human physiology, emphasizing integration across systems, clinical relevance, and research methodology. Core Academic Domains Neurophysiology: neuronal excitability, synaptic transmission, higher cortical functions Cardiovascular Physiology: cardiac electrophysiology, hemodynamics, regulation of blood pressure Respiratory Physiology: gas exchange, ventilation-perfusion relationships, control of respiration Renal Physiology: Glomerular filtration, tubular transport, fluid-electrolyte and acid–base balance Endocrinology: hormonal regulation, feedback mechanisms, metabolic integration Reproductive Physiology: gametogenesis, hormonal cycles, fertility regulation Electrophysiology: ECG, EMG, nerve conduction, and applied diagnostic techniques Training Dimensions Experimental physiology and laboratory techniques Clinical physiology and diagnostic interpretation Quantitative data analysis and interpretation Research methodology, biostatistics, and scientific writing Teaching methodology (pedagogy) and academic communication 3. About 14% of the global burden of disease has been attributed to neuropsychiatric disorders, mostly due to the chronically disabling nature of depression and other common mental disorders, alcohol-use and substance-use disorders, and psychoses. Such estimates have drawn attention to the importance of mental disorders for public health. The burden of mental disorders is likely to have been underestimated because of inadequate appreciation of the connectedness between mental illness and other health conditions. Because these interactions are protean, there can be no health without mental health.
